Donington Results

October 18, 2008

Saturday saw Rob qualify 13th & 12th for the first two races of the weekend.  The first of the weekends three races didn’t go exactly to plan.  As the cars headed out for their warm up lap the rain started to fall.  Starting from row 7 on the grid Rob made a decent start, but the rain was new to him and on the slick tyres he was struggling for grip.  He said: “I held onto the back of the group till around lap 7 I think, but a soon as they had a gap I couldn’t close it, in the end I decided to drive to the finish rather than risk crashing”.  He finished 13th overall and 5th in class.

Race 2 was on Saturday morning.  With the circuit still wet from over night rain most drivers were on wet tyres.  The race was a similar affair to race 1.  Rob had a decent battle with some of the other scholarship class drivers.  He end up 13th overall and 4th in class.

A long wait until race 3, with the sun starting to set in the background, but finally some dry track time.  Starting from row 7 on the grid Rob made a bad get away with too much wheel spin and lost two places.  A battle ensued and the lead group of 8 got away.  Rob made it to the front of the second pack after a fantastic battle with four other cars.  Towards the latter stage of the race Findlay, the eventual scholarship class winner, was quicker and overtook Rob.  That was how it stayed to the finish.  Rob ended up 10th overall and 2nd in class.

He said: “It was a really enjoyable race, a shame that I got a bad start because I think that we could have stayed with the lead group and who knows what could have happened then.  The weekend has been great, we’ve made a step forward from Silverstone and that promising for next year”.
